About Barangay Concepcion
Situated in Alitagtag, Batangas, Barangay Concepcion is one of 19 barangays that make up the municipality within CALABARZON.
According to the 2020 Philippine census, Barangay Concepcion had a population of 618. This made it the 19th largest of 19 barangays in Alitagtag by population, placing it among the smaller barangays of the municipality. Residents of Barangay Concepcion accounted for approximately 2.30% of the total population of Alitagtag, which stood at 26,819 in the same census year.
Census comparisons between 2015 and 2020 show Barangay Concepcion moving from 539 residents to 618 residents, an intercensal change of +14.7%. The trajectory indicates a growing community. Barangay Concepcion is officially classified as rural, a designation applied to barangays with lower population density and predominantly non-built-up land use.
Alitagtag is a municipality comprising 19 barangays, and serves as the governing unit directly responsible for local services in Barangay Concepcion, including public health, sanitation, peace and order, and civil registration. Within the wider province of Batangas, which contains 1,078 barangays across its component cities and municipalities, Barangay Concepcion ranks 993rd by 2020 population. Batangas is classified as a 1st by the Bureau of Local Government Finance, a category that reflects the province's annual regular income.
The barangay's legislative and executive affairs are handled by a Punong Barangay and the Sangguniang Barangay, elected nationwide during the Barangay and SK Elections. The next BSKE is scheduled for Monday, November 2, 2026, following the synchronized election schedule set by COMELEC Resolution No. 11191.
